Перейти к содержанию

API

API в Platrum используется для индивидуальной настройки системы. Вы сможете настроить Platrum так, как удобно вам. Например, можно создавать транзакции, приглашать пользователей или ставить задачи.

Если вам необходимо настроить какую-либо автоматизацию или интеграцию с другими вашими системами, в этом также может помочь API Platrum.

Как получить API-ключ

Для работы с вашим проектом по API вам потребуется API-ключ. Его вы сможете найти в разделе «Настройки» –> «Проект» в поле API-ключ.

Картинка

Картинка

API-ключ доступен только владельцу проекта. У приглашенного сотрудника не будет доступа к ключу. В этом случае он может выполнять запросы к API с помощью своего session_id. Его можно посмотреть в Network браузера.

В этом случае сотруднику, работающему с проектом по API будут доступны только те данные, которые доступны ему в проекте. Если сотрудник в качестве API-ключа использует свой session_id и делает запрос к тем данным, к которым у него нет доступа по настройкам, то он не сможет их получить, в ответе на запрос придет «permission_denied» (доступ запрещен).

Важно: Если вы, как владелец, передадите свой api-ключ из настроек проекта другому человеку, то данные никак не ограничить, т.к. для системы такой запрос выполняет владелец проекта.

Поэтому не передавайте API-ключ третьим лицам. При наличии API-ключа можно выполнить любое действие в вашем проекте от лица владельца, что может нанести вам ущерб.

Если в документации неполная информация

Документация по работе с API находится в процессе заполнения, в ней может отсутствовать описание некоторых методов.

Если в процессе работы вы не нашли в документации описания нужного вам метода, вы можете посмотреть его формат в консоли вашего браузера.

Если этого недостаточно, напишите нам через виджет чата или на почту support@platrum.ru, наши сотрудники передадут вопрос разработчикам продукта, и мы поможем разобраться.